repo.or.cz
/
wine.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
msi: Convert REG_DWORD properties to strings in MsiGetProductInfo.
2008-02-18
J
a
mes Hawkins
m
si: Convert
REG_DWORD properti
e
s to strings in
M
siGetP
r
oduc
.
.
.
commit
|
commitdiff
|
tree
2008-02-18
James
H
awkins
m
s
i
: Set the Us
e
r
La
n
g
uageID p
r
operty
.
commit
|
commitdiff
|
tree
2008-02-16
James Hawkins
tools/wine
.
inf: Cre
a
te fake dll
s
for
i
tircl
.
d
l
l
and
.
.
.
commit
|
commitdiff
|
tree
2008-02-16
James
Hawk
i
n
s
tools/
w
ine
.
inf: Create a
f
ake
f
ile for hh
.
exe
.
commit
|
commitdiff
|
tree
2008-02-16
Jam
e
s Haw
k
ins
i
t
ircl: Add a stub im
p
lementati
o
n of itircl
.
dll
.
commit
|
commitdiff
|
tree
2008-02-13
James Hawkins
m
s
i: Add tests for sou
r
ce
f
older
resolution
.
commit
|
commitdiff
|
tree
2008-02-12
James
H
a
w
kins
m
s
i: Handle c
a
r
riage returns in MsiD
a
tabaseImport
.
commit
|
commitdiff
|
tree
2008-02-12
James
Hawkins
msi: Use Ms
i
Vi
e
wModify instead
of bui
l
ding a
SQL query
.
.
.
commit
|
commitdiff
|
tree
2008-02-12
James H
a
w
k
ins
msi: Read the
language info
f
ro
m
t
h
e file
.
commit
|
commitdiff
|
tree
2008-02-12
James
Hawkins
msi: Reimplement MsiGetProductInf
o
.
commit
|
commitdiff
|
tree
2008-02-11
James Hawkins
msi: Test the rema
i
ning in
s
tal
l
e
r
p
r
o
p
erties ret
u
rned
.
.
.
commit
|
commitdiff
|
tree
2008-02-11
James
H
aw
k
ins
msi: Return E
R
ROR_INVALID_
P
A
R
AMETER if szProduct is
.
.
.
commit
|
commitdiff
|
tree
2008-02-11
James Haw
k
i
ns
msi: Add t
e
sts for MsiGetProductI
n
fo
.
commit
|
commitdiff
|
tree
2008-02-11
Ja
m
es
Hawkin
s
msi: Successfully re
t
urn an empty str
i
ng
w
h
en r
e
questi
n
g
.
.
.
commit
|
commitdiff
|
tree
2008-02-11
James Hawkins
msi: Don't che
c
k for the ex
i
stence of
t
he msi pa
c
kage
.
.
.
commit
|
commitdiff
|
tree
2008-02-11
James Hawki
n
s
msi: Handle the sp
e
cial table _For
c
eCo
d
epage in MsiData
b
a
s
e
E
.
.
.
commit
|
commitdiff
|
tree
2008-02-11
Jam
e
s Hawki
n
s
msi: Add tests
f
or not using qu
o
tes in SQL q
u
eri
e
s
.
commit
|
commitdiff
|
tree
2008-02-07
Jame
s
H
awki
n
s
msi:
Test using
c
arriage returns i
n
SQL querie
s
and
.
.
.
commit
|
commitdiff
|
tree
2008-02-05
James H
a
wkin
s
msi
:
Fix handling of
t
h
e
NULL sep
a
r
a
tor when writi
n
g
.
.
.
commit
|
commitdiff
|
tree
2008-02-05
Ja
m
es Hawkins
msi:
R
eim
p
lemen
t
MsiFor
m
atRecord
.
commit
|
commitdiff
|
tree
2008-02-05
J
a
mes Hawkins
msi: Add more
tests
f
o
r
M
s
iFormatRec
o
rd
.
commit
|
commitdiff
|
tree
2008-02-05
James Hawkins
msi: Return ERROR_MO
R
E_DATA
i
f the size is t
o
o small
.
commit
|
commitdiff
|
tree
2008-02-05
James Haw
k
i
n
s
m
s
i
: Return the string
lengt
h
eve
n
i
f
the string i
s
.
.
.
commit
|
commitdiff
|
tree
2008-02-05
James Hawkins
msi: Leave room fo
r
the
N
ULL terminator
.
commit
|
commitdiff
|
tree
2008-02-05
James Hawki
n
s
msi
:
Return ERR
O
R_F
I
L
E
_INV
A
LID if the file
h
as
n
o
version
.
.
.
commit
|
commitdiff
|
tree
2008-02-05
J
ames Hawkins
msi: Return ERROR_I
N
V
A
L
I
D_PAR
A
METER if a
s
t
ring
po
i
n
t
er
.
.
.
commit
|
commitdiff
|
tree
2008-02-05
Jam
e
s
Hawk
i
n
s
msi: Transl
a
t
e ERR
O
R_BAD_PATHNAME into ERROR_FILE_N
O
T
_
FOUND
.
commit
|
commitdiff
|
tree
2008-02-05
James Hawkins
m
s
i:
Onl
y
convert
o
utput strings if the
call succeeded
.
commit
|
commitdiff
|
tree
2008-02-05
James Haw
k
in
s
m
s
i:
Add t
e
s
t
s
fo
r
MsiGetFileVersion
.
commit
|
commitdiff
|
tree
2008-02-05
Ja
m
e
s Hawkin
s
msi:
I
m
p
lement
the MS
I
M
ODIFY_ASSIGN action of Msi
V
iewM
o
dify
.
.
.
commit
|
commitdiff
|
tree
2008-02-05
J
a
mes
H
aw
k
ins
msi: Add tests
f
o
r using
sin
g
le quotes in an INSERT
.
.
.
commit
|
commitdiff
|
tree
2008-02-05
James Hawkins
v
e
rsion: R
e
turn
ERROR_R
E
SOURCE_DATA_NOT_FOUND if the
.
.
.
commit
|
commitdiff
|
tree
2008-02-05
James
H
awki
n
s
ker
n
el32: Fac
t
or ou
t
the VerifyV
e
rsionIn
f
o tests i
n
to
.
.
.
commit
|
commitdiff
|
tree
2008-01-21
James Haw
k
ins
m
s
i
: Add mor
e
MsiFormatReco
r
d tests
.
commit
|
commitdiff
|
tree
2008-01-16
James
Hawki
n
s
propsys
:
Add a s
t
u
b
implement
a
t
i
o
n of propsys
.
dll
.
commit
|
commitdiff
|
tree
2008-01-16
James Hawkins
msi: dest
_
path refer
s
to th
e
d
i
rectory
p
r
e
fix
,
not
.
.
.
commit
|
commitdiff
|
tree
2008-01-09
James Hawk
i
ns
msi: Actua
l
ly del
e
te the
row data instead of blanking
.
.
.
commit
|
commitdiff
|
tree
2008-01-09
Ja
m
e
s
H
a
wkins
m
si: Te
s
t
c
ommitting a
tab
l
e wit
h
a removed row
.
commit
|
commitdiff
|
tree
2008-01-09
James H
a
wkins
msi: Handle markers in
t
h
e
W
HERE section of a
n
UPDA
T
E
.
.
.
commit
|
commitdiff
|
tree
2008-01-07
James Hawkins
msi: Create paren
t
direct
o
ries when d
u
plic
a
tin
g
f
ile
s
.
.
.
commit
|
commitdiff
|
tree
2008-01-07
J
a
mes Hawkins
msi: Pad the
m
o
n
th and day t
o
t
w
o digits
.
commit
|
commitdiff
|
tree
2008-01-07
James H
a
wk
i
n
s
msi: Remove an erroneou
s
table
.
commit
|
commitdiff
|
tree
2008-01-07
James Hawk
i
ns
msi: Copy the temporary p
a
ckage
w
h
en sto
r
ing the instal
l
er
.
commit
|
commitdiff
|
tree
2008-01-07
Jam
e
s
H
awkins
msi: Check
th
e
local packa
g
e for
e
xist
e
nce when resolv
i
n
g
.
.
.
commit
|
commitdiff
|
tree
2008-01-07
James Hawkins
msi: Di
r
ect
l
y
download
m
i->sou
r
ce now that Source
D
ir
.
.
.
commit
|
commitdiff
|
tree
2008-01-07
James H
a
wkins
msi:
OriginalDatabase can be a UR
L
so
check fo
r
a forw
a
rd
.
.
.
commit
|
commitdiff
|
tree
2008-01-07
Ja
m
es
Ha
w
k
ins
m
si: SourceDir is f
o
rmed
from
the
p
ath of OriginalDatabase
.
commit
|
commitdiff
|
tree
2008-01-07
J
a
mes Hawkins
msi: Orig
i
n
a
lDatabase is t
h
e
f
ully-expanded p
a
th
t
o
.
.
.
commit
|
commitdiff
|
tree
2008-01-07
James Hawkins
msi: Factor out msi_s
e
t_
s
o
u
r
c
edir_props
.
commit
|
commitdiff
|
tree
2008-01-07
James Ha
w
kins
msi: If
t
h
e package is a UR
L
,
t
h
e Origina
l
Database
.
.
.
commit
|
commitdiff
|
tree
2008-01-07
James Hawkins
ms
i
: WriteEnvironmentS
t
rings should also write to REG_EXPAND
.
.
.
commit
|
commitdiff
|
tree
2008-01-07
James Hawkins
msi: Only read an
i
nte
r
n
a
l package if the file t
o
instal
l
.
.
.
commit
|
commitdiff
|
tree
2007-12-23
James Hawkins
msi:
A
llow whitespace
a
fter the prope
r
ty name when
.
.
.
commit
|
commitdiff
|
tree
2007-12-23
James Hawkins
msi: Allow the n
o
t-equal
oper
a
tor i
n
WHE
R
E
que
r
y string
.
.
.
commit
|
commitdiff
|
tree
2007-12-23
James Ha
w
kins
msi:
Fix
d
e
leting temporary rows, with
tests
.
commit
|
commitdiff
|
tree
2007-12-20
James
Hawkins
msi: The BS_GRO
U
PBOX st
y
le should only b
e
used if the
.
.
.
commit
|
commitdiff
|
tree
2007-12-20
James Hawkins
msi: Initialize a d
e
fa
u
lt
C
O
M apartment fo
r
custom
.
.
.
commit
|
commitdiff
|
tree
2007-12-20
James Hawkins
msi: Allow NU
L
L
p
arameters to be p
a
s
sed to
t
he local
.
.
.
commit
|
commitdiff
|
tree
2007-12-19
James H
a
wk
i
ns
msi:
Fr
e
e the or
d
ering i
n
fo
r
ma
t
i
on
.
commit
|
commitdiff
|
tree
2007-12-18
James H
a
wkins
msi: Sort each table
of the join
s
eparately
.
commit
|
commitdiff
|
tree
2007-12-18
J
a
mes H
a
wkins
msi: Test
s
ort
i
ng
a
table usin
g
a c
o
lu
m
n that is n
o
t
.
.
.
commit
|
commitdiff
|
tree
2007-12-17
James Hawkins
m
si
:
Set th
e
t
e
xt
color after ca
l
ling the win
d
ow proc
.
commit
|
commitdiff
|
tree
2007-12-17
Ja
m
es Hawkins
msi: The lin
e
cont
r
ol ha
s
a height o
f
exactly
2
de
v
ice
.
.
.
commit
|
commitdiff
|
tree
2007-12-17
Ja
m
es
H
a
w
kins
msi: Return ERR
O
R_
I
NVA
L
ID_
P
AR
A
METER if the prod
u
ct
.
.
.
commit
|
commitdiff
|
tree
2007-12-17
Ja
m
es Hawkins
msi:
R
etu
r
n ERROR_U
N
KNOWN_CO
M
PONE
N
T if no products
.
.
.
commit
|
commitdiff
|
tree
2007-12-17
J
ame
s
Hawkins
msi: Also check the l
o
cal sys
t
e
m
component key for
.
.
.
commit
|
commitdiff
|
tree
2007-12-17
James Hawkins
msi: Ch
e
ck the
user componen
t
key for the clients
.
commit
|
commitdiff
|
tree
2007-12-17
James Hawkins
msi: Validate the para
m
e
t
ers of Msi
E
n
um
C
lients
.
commit
|
commitdiff
|
tree
2007-12-17
Ja
m
es
H
a
wki
n
s
msi:
Ad
d
t
e
s
ts for MsiEnumC
l
ients
.
commit
|
commitdiff
|
tree
2007-12-17
J
a
mes Hawkins
msi:
Simplify Expan
d
AnyPa
t
h
.
commit
|
commitdiff
|
tree
2007-12-17
J
a
mes Hawkins
msi: Verif
y
that t
h
e
PID_PAGECOUNT and PID
_
REV
N
U
MB
E
R
.
.
.
commit
|
commitdiff
|
tree
2007-12-17
James Ha
w
kins
msi: If the package doesn't exist,
r
eturn ERRO
R
_FILE_NOT_FOUND
.
commit
|
commitdiff
|
tree
2007-12-17
James Ha
w
k
i
ns
m
s
i: Valida
t
e
the pa
r
ame
t
ers of
M
siOpenPackage
.
commit
|
commitdiff
|
tree
2007-12-17
James H
a
wkins
m
s
i:
Ad
d
more tests fo
r
MsiOpenPacka
g
e
.
commit
|
commitdiff
|
tree
2007-12-17
James Hawkins
msi: Release the
re
c
ord when
l
oad
i
ng the ha
s
h dat
a
.
commit
|
commitdiff
|
tree
2007-12-14
James H
a
wkins
msi:
Close
the file
h
andle returned by FindFirstF
i
le
.
commit
|
commitdiff
|
tree
2007-12-12
Ja
m
es Hawkins
m
si: Fr
e
e the cabinet string
on error
.
commit
|
commitdiff
|
tree
2007-12-12
James
H
awkin
s
msi: Properly re
l
e
a
s
e
the re
c
ord
.
commit
|
commitdiff
|
tree
2007-12-12
Jame
s
Hawkin
s
msi: Free the
u
s
e
r sid str
i
ng
.
commit
|
commitdiff
|
tree
2007-12-12
James Hawkins
msi: Free the
deform
a
tted st
r
ing
.
commit
|
commitdiff
|
tree
2007-12-08
James Hawkins
m
s
i:
Handle the Comp
L
ocator table
i
n the AppSea
r
c
h
.
.
.
commit
|
commitdiff
|
tree
2007-12-08
James Hawk
i
ns
m
si: Reimpleme
n
t
MsiGetProdu
c
tCode
.
commit
|
commitdiff
|
tree
2007-12-08
James Hawkins
m
si: Remove t
w
o tests tha
t
d
e
pend on th
e
sort order
.
.
.
commit
|
commitdiff
|
tree
2007-12-07
J
a
m
es Hawkins
m
s
i: Add
t
ests fo
r
MsiGetPr
o
du
c
tCode
.
commit
|
commitdiff
|
tree
2007-12-05
J
a
m
e
s Hawk
i
ns
m
s
i: Reim
p
lem
e
nt Ms
i
GetComponentPath
.
commit
|
commitdiff
|
tree
2007-12-05
J
ames Hawkins
m
s
i: Add tests fo
r
MsiGetCo
m
ponentPath
.
commit
|
commitdiff
|
tree
2007-12-04
J
a
mes Hawk
i
ns
msi: Test t
h
e Com
p
Lo
c
ator s
u
bset of the
A
ppSearch action
.
commit
|
commitdiff
|
tree
2007-12-03
J
a
mes Hawkins
ms
i
: Ad
d
a stub imp
l
em
e
ntati
o
n of MsiEnumComponent
C
os
t
s
W
.
commit
|
commitdiff
|
tree
2007-12-03
James
H
awkin
s
msi
:
I
m
p
l
e
ment
t
he Vers
i
on property of
t
he Installer
.
.
.
commit
|
commitdiff
|
tree
2007-12-03
James Haw
k
ins
msi:
Test the CCPSearch action
.
commit
|
commitdiff
|
tree
2007-12-03
J
a
m
e
s
Haw
k
ins
msi: Use a hash table for reor
d
e
ring rows in a WHERE
.
.
.
commit
|
commitdiff
|
tree
2007-11-29
Ja
m
es H
a
wkins
ms
i
: Don't c
h
eck
f
or th
e
m
edia
o
r c
a
binet if t
h
e ca
b
inet
.
.
.
commit
|
commitdiff
|
tree
2007-11-29
James Hawki
n
s
msi: Make sure attr is valid bef
o
re checking for the
.
.
.
commit
|
commitdiff
|
tree
2007-11-26
James Hawki
n
s
msi: D
o
wngrad
e
an ERR to a WARN
.
commit
|
commitdiff
|
tree
2007-11-26
Jam
e
s Ha
w
kins
msi
:
Fix
the c
o
nd
i
tion of a FIXME
.
commit
|
commitdiff
|
tree
2007-11-26
Jam
e
s Hawkins
m
s
i:
D
owngrade an ERR to a WA
R
N
.
commit
|
commitdiff
|
tree
2007-11-26
J
a
mes
H
awkins
msi: Down
g
rad
e
a
FIXME
t
o
a WARN
.
commit
|
commitdiff
|
tree
2007-11-26
James Haw
k
ins
m
s
i:
Only check the volume label if it'
s
different
.
.
.
commit
|
commitdiff
|
tree
2007-11-26
J
a
m
es Haw
k
ins
msi: Check the destination file
'
s
hash
a
nd skip that
.
.
.
commit
|
commitdiff
|
tree
2007-11-26
J
ames
H
awkins
msi: S
e
t the f
i
le contents of the file h
a
sh te
s
t file
.
.
.
commit
|
commitdiff
|
tree
next